How much does full time daycare cost in Ontario?

Paying for child care A 2019 national survey of child care fees, found that Ontario cities had the highest median full-time centre based and regulated home child care infant fees in the country at $1,774 a month or $21,288 annually. Fees in rural areas in Ontario tended to be comparable to fees in nearby cities.

How much does daycare cost in Buffalo NY?

How much does daycare cost in Buffalo? The cost of daycare in Buffalo is $925 per month. This is the average price for full-time, based on CareLuLu data, including homes and centers.

Will Alberta get $10 a day daycare?

The Prime Minister, Justin Trudeau, and the Premier of Alberta, Jason Kenney, today announced that both governments have reached an agreement that will support an average of $10‑a‑day care in the province, significantly reducing the price of child care for families.

How do I open a daycare in Alberta?

To apply for a facility-based child care licence in Alberta, contact early learning and child care staff. They will take you through the steps you need to take to prepare and apply for a licence and will provide you with a child care licence application package.

How much is baby bonus in Ontario?

How Much Ontario Child Benefit Will You Receive? You will get up to a maximum of $1,473.96 per child per year or $122.83 per month per child under 18 years of age. If your family net income is above $22,504, you may receive a partial benefit.

What is the maximum income to qualify for child care subsidy in Ontario?

Generally speaking, if your total family income is $111,000 or less you may qualify for the childcare subsidy. Even if you earn more than $111,000, your family may still qualify, so it’s still worth applying.

What are day care surgeries?

Day Care surgeries are for patients who require a surgical procedure without an overnight admission to the hospital. Depending on the procedure, some patients will require an overnight stay (in-patients) and some patients will be able to return home the same day (out-patients).
